JJS Hedge Fund Activity: Q1 2023 in Review

3 of the 6,275 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in iPath Series B Bloomberg Softs Subindex Total ReturnSM ETN (JJS) for Q1 2023, worth a combined $979K — down 86% from $7.2M a quarter earlier.

Sellers outnumbered buyers: 3 funds closed out of JJS and 1 opened new positions — a net loss of 2 holders — while 1 trimmed existing stakes and 1 added.

The largest buyer was Cetera Advisors, opening a new position worth an estimated $527K. The largest seller was Barclays, exiting entirely with an estimated $4.96M sold.
